Abstract(in English) | In this paper, I propose a new method to train similarity for labeling characters' ID to manga character regions. In manga, manga characters are important elements. If they can be retrieved, it's possible to meet user's demand. Labeling to manga characters is difficult with simple pattern matching because the manga characters have the various directions of the faces and expressions. Conventional method's problem is labeling many manga characters. In addition, human have to choose many kinds of face data. In this paper, the proposed method employs pool-based active learning to solves these problems. Pool-based active learning has an advantage to solve the problem when obtaining samples with labels requires quite higher cost than the cost to obtain samples without labels. I used our method for labeling experiment and show its advantages. |
